The author proves that the solution of the nonlinear boundary value problem \[ \text{div}(k \nabla T)= 0\quad\text{in }\Omega,\quad -k\nabla(T\cdot n)= af(T)- b\quad\text{on }\partial\Omega, \] where \(\Omega\subset\mathbb{R}^3\) is a bounded domain. \(T\), the unknown, can be obtained by successive approximations with solutions of a corresponding linear problem.
